Immunotherapy — harnessing the immune system to fight cancer — is positioned to revolutionize the way we treat cancer. Physicians and researchers from Moores Cancer Center at UC San Diego Health and La Jolla Institute for Allergy and Immunology will offer an overview of this cutting-edge approach and explain the latest developments in promising therapies, including immune checkpoint inhibitors and cellular therapy. Learn about how to access FDA-approved immunotherapy treatments and about clinical trials that are testing new options for cancers that have been particularly resistant to traditional treatments.
